Output e51e1479f813fdc2bfe77535c1e0a2e46e70171e40256b9e7d2cb893b2efacab:0

value
362261228
script pubkey
OP_0 OP_PUSHBYTES_20 502a6148b460b63fe582cdf9f621445763e9224a
address
tb1q2q4xzj95vzmrlevzehulvg2y2a37jgj287cp9v
transaction
e51e1479f813fdc2bfe77535c1e0a2e46e70171e40256b9e7d2cb893b2efacab